[The Epoch Times, January 28, 2023](Epoch Times reporters Xia Song and Luo Ya interviewed and reported) The infection rate in China has soared to 80% to 90%, making it the country with the highest infection rate in the world.In December last year, the National School of Development of Peking University reported that the number of infected people nationwide was about900 million

The number of infected people is so high that the infectedsequelaebecome one of the focus of public attention. Many of the sequelae are wheezing, fatigue, cough, and brain fog (cognitive dysfunction), which often co-occur with varying degrees, and the proportion of insomnia, anxiety, and depression is also high.

According to a comprehensive analysis of 120,000 infected people who developed new crowns (original) found that the incidence of sequelae was 56.9%, and fatigue was the first; neurological and cardiovascular diseases more often occurred in women; the older the age, the more mental, respiratory, digestive, skin and other conditions appeared.

A young couple in Shanghai told the Epoch Times reporter that after a month of exposure to the sun, they still have symptoms of coughing and lung pain when they talk for a long time. Easily fatigued and drowsy. But there is no way, I have to go to work, otherwise there will be no salary.

Hu Liren, a former entrepreneur in Shanghai, told The Epoch Times that the sequelae of the epidemic are relatively common and even serious for many people. “It’s the same when I was infected the second time. My classmate has been coughing for more than a month, and it still hasn’t recovered.”

He also said that many people died in Shanghai. At the peak, more than 4,000 people died every day, about 12 times more than usual. Many of my friends’ parents passed away, and his father also passed away.

Because the younger brother was familiar with the people in the hospital, Hu Liren’s father was admitted to the hospital relatively smoothly. He said: “My father died after staying in the hospital for 2 days. He did not enter the ICU, nor was he on a ventilator, but on oxygen.”

Zhang Hua (pseudonym), an independent media person in Beijing, told the reporter that the sequelae of the epidemic are severe, and the outpatient clinic is still very tense.

He said, “A friend of mine has had positive symptoms since December 20 last year. He has been coughing for a month, with a sore throat and shortness of breath.”

In addition, Zhang Hua also revealed that he discovered today that some outpatient clinics in Beijing are still queuing up, mainly children. He said: “Now the infection rate among children is at its peak. The official internal news has not disclosed it to the outside world.”
